What Is the Cost of Living Near Laredo?

Understanding the cost of living near Laredo is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Parks & Recreation Department.
Laredo's Cost of Living Index is approximately 80.5 (19.5% less expensive than US average; 13.4% less than TX average). Border city, major trade hub, very affordable housing. El Metro.
